Choosing your MRI acquisition

You'll probably use our [:ImagingSequences:default MRI sequences]. However, you might want to use another protocol (for example, to change the number of slices) but you must discuss it with the Radiographers. If you're doing anything exotic, you should also contact the Physicists (Marta, Stefan or Rhodri).
